The Air Command is a great unit, but I would be cautious- Atwood was buying the company, but now that Dometic has purchased Atwood, there are questions whether the Australian government will allow the deal to go through. It may be that unit will be orphaned (it may be the same for the Atwood helium refrigerators)- or it may not. Atwood has offered air conditioners and refrigerators in the past which are orphans.
Gree is another brand of rooftop units, built by a long time manufacturer of air conditioners.
